Output 5752777ed5df8397236b000b53187fbfb81a66825ad41341fb64ceeec7f1e3cc:0

value
18417876
script pubkey
OP_0 OP_PUSHBYTES_20 e3d76f0cf5eee38805c80611aa14ed0e8b100009
address
ltc1qu0tk7r84am3cspwgqcg6598dp693qqqfluhv0q
transaction
5752777ed5df8397236b000b53187fbfb81a66825ad41341fb64ceeec7f1e3cc
spent
true